Transaction d7246b973113dc160df89c96909f65a3764d703acaf73274ac70fc1e3cc860e6

1 Input
2 Outputs
  • d7246b973113dc160df89c96909f65a3764d703acaf73274ac70fc1e3cc860e6:0
  • value  170163
    address  37dwBtY7pSzuVkZLBVJoY4kJX595Ua6rUV
  • d7246b973113dc160df89c96909f65a3764d703acaf73274ac70fc1e3cc860e6:1
  • value  15606874
    address  1KbvxhQSobjxphz59BeuCrEkUM34MhvVx1